SQL

Comprendre les différentes catégories de commandes SQL

SQL, ou Structured Query Language, est composé de plusieurs catégories de commandes, chacune ayant un rôle spécifique dans la manipulation et la gestion des bases de données relationnelles. Les principales catégories sont le Data Definition Language (DDL), le Data Manipulation Language (DML), le Data Control Language (DCL) et le Transaction Control Language (TCL).


1. Data Definition Language (DDL)


DDL est utilisé pour définir et gérer la structure des objets dans une base de données. Voici quelques-unes des commandes les plus couramment utilisées dans DDL :


  • CREATE : Utilisée pour créer de nouveaux objets dans la base de données, tels que des tables, des vues, des index, etc.
  • ALTER : Utilisée pour modifier la structure des objets existants dans la base de données, tels que l'ajout ou la suppression de colonnes dans une table.
  • DROP : Utilisée pour supprimer des objets de la base de données, tels que des tables, des vues, des index, etc.


2. Data Manipulation Language (DML)


DML est utilisé pour manipuler les données stockées dans la base de données. Voici quelques-unes des commandes les plus couramment utilisées dans DML :


  • INSERT INTO : Utilisée pour insérer de nouvelles lignes de données dans une table.
  • SELECT : Utilisée pour récupérer des données à partir de la base de données en utilisant des critères spécifiés.
  • UPDATE : Utilisée pour mettre à jour des données existantes dans une table.
  • DELETE : Utilisée pour supprimer des lignes de données d'une table.


3. Data Control Language (DCL)


DCL est utilisé pour gérer les autorisations et les permissions dans la base de données. Voici quelques-unes des commandes les plus couramment utilisées dans DCL :

  • GRANT : Utilisée pour accorder des autorisations à des utilisateurs ou à des rôles sur des objets de la base de données.
  • REVOKE : Utilisée pour révoquer des autorisations accordées précédemment à des utilisateurs ou à des rôles.


4. Transaction Control Language (TCL)


TCL est utilisé pour gérer les transactions dans la base de données. Voici quelques-unes des commandes les plus couramment utilisées dans TCL :


  • BEGIN TRANSACTION : Utilisée pour démarrer une nouvelle transaction.
  • COMMIT : Utilisée pour valider une transaction et appliquer les modifications à la base de données.
  • ROLLBACK : Utilisée pour annuler une transaction et restaurer la base de données à son état précédent avant le début de la transaction.


En comprenant ces différentes catégories de commandes SQL, vous serez en mesure de manipuler efficacement la structure et les données de votre base de données, ainsi que de gérer les autorisations et les transactions.

2952 vues
Modifié le 26 mars 2024
Publicité Sitedudev
Cette pub permet au site de vivre ...
Publicité
Cette pub permet au site de vivre ...
Voir d'autres articles
3 090 vues
Twitter Cards
Les Twitter Cards sont des protocoles qui vous permettent d’attacher des photos, des vidéos et autres médias interactifs à vos tweets afin d’amener...
Créer son site
413 vues
Création d'un fichier .htaccess
Le fichier .htaccess est un élément important pour configurer et personnaliser un site web sur un serveur Apache. Dans ce cours, nous allons apprendre comment créer un fichier .htaccess de...
HTACCESS
697 vues
Gestion des événements : click, submit, keydown, etc.
Gestion des Événements en JavaScriptLa gestion des événements en JavaScript permet d'interagir avec les actions de l'utilisateur sur une page web, telles que les clics de souris, les soumissions...
JS
1 646 vues
Utiliser les opérations mathématiques (+, -, *, /) dans les styles
Utiliser les opérations mathématiques en SASS : +, -, , /1. Addition (+), Soustraction (-), Multiplication (*), Division (/) :En SASS, vous pouvez effectuer des opérations mathématiques...
Sass
263 vues
CSS interne : l'utilisation de balises <style> dans la section <head> du document HTML
CSS Interne : L'utilisation de balises <style> dans la section <head> du document HTMLLe CSS interne est une méthode de stylisation où les styles sont définis directement dans la...
CSS
816 vues
Inline CSS : l'ajout de styles directement dans les balises HTML
Inline CSS : L'ajout de styles directement dans les balises HTMLL'Inline CSS est une méthode de stylisation où les styles sont appliqués directement à un élément HTML via l'attribut style. Cela...
CSS
3 336 vues
Mise en évidence du texte avec <em>, <strong>, <u> et <s>
Mise en évidence du texte avec <em>, <strong>, <u> et <s>Les balises <em>, <strong>, <u> et <s> sont utilisées pour mettre en évidence le texte dans...
HTML
478 vues
Comprendre le rôle de JavaScript dans le développement web
Le rôle de JavaScript dans le développement webJavaScript est un langage de programmation qui joue un rôle crucial dans le développement web moderne. Il est largement utilisé pour rendre les...
JS
Publicité
Cette pub permet au site de vivre ...